WebMar 20, 2024 · The fifth stage of Erikson's theory of psychosocial development is the identity versus role confusion stage. It occurs during adolescence, from about 12 to 18 years. During this stage, adolescents develop a personal identity and a sense of self. Teens explore different roles, attitudes, and identities as they develop a sense of self. WebPhysical Development. During adolescence the body usually experiences a growth spurt, which is a time of very rapid growth in height and weight. WebIt may occur as early as age 9, or as late as age 16. The average age of menstruation in the United States is about 12 years. Girls growth spurt peaks around age 11.5 and slows around age 16. Boys: Boys may begin to notice that their testicles and scrotum grow as early as age 9. Soon, the penis begins to lengthen.
